JOINT BASE SAN ANTONIO-LACKLAND, Texas - In 1961, during the speed run launched on a course at Edwards Air Force Base, Calif., the B-58 Hustler bomber blew past Mach 2, the 1,584 mph barrier, hitting a top speed of 2,095 mph.
